## Configuration

Grindle's report builder uses stable sort by default. Set GRINDLE_SORT_STABLE=true before release cuts; unstable sort reorders tied rows between runs and breaks diff-based QA. Pin the collation locale too, or column ordering shifts on the Fenwick cluster. Both settings live in the release env file. Append the report-signing secret directly below this line in that file.

sealed setting: VAULT_KEY13=741e0a90de233

- [ ] Key ceremony, step 4 (Glassmere release): confirm the contrast-audit attestation bundle is sealed before key rotation. Verify WCAG report hashes match the Ironquill ledger, with two witnesses present. Record timestamps in the ceremony log. Unseal the attestation vault only after quorum, using the recovery passphrase that follows.

vault phrase of kawep-tahog = ulaix-briath

## Deployment

This service runs the Farelight ticket-pricing experiment for the Brindlewood venues. Deploys go through the standard pipeline: merge to main, wait for the canary stage, then promote. The experiment assigns visitors to pricing arms at session start, so never deploy mid-peak or you'll skew the buckets. Rollbacks are safe because arm assignments are sticky. Before promoting, confirm the pricing service is running with the following configuration values.

settings of bawif-fawif:
ralix:
  log_level: warn
  metrics_host: metrics.ralix.tolvaqsys.internal
  pool_size: 32